START-UP DEVICENET
33.1. Safety instructions
WARNING!
Risk.of.injury.from.improper.operation!
Improper operation may result in injuries as well as damage to the device and the area around it
• Before start-up, ensure that the operating personnel are familiar with and completely understand the contents
of the operating instructions.
• Observe the safety instructions and intended use.
• Only adequately trained personnel may start up the equipment/the device.
Before start-up, carry out fluid installation (see Chapter “13”) and electrical installation (Chapter “32”) of
Type 8792/8793 and of the valve.
